What connects these sectors in Opal is a shared operational pattern: information arrives in one system, a person manually transfers it to another, someone else acts on it, and a third person reports the result. AI automation collapses that chain into a single triggered workflow — the data moves, the action fires, and the report generates without anyone touching a keyboard. That's the fundamental shift we build for Opal businesses: removing the human-as-middleware pattern from workflows where human judgment isn't the bottleneck.

How Cloud Consulting Supports Opal Businesses

Cloud consulting for Opal businesses means migrating your critical systems to the right cloud infrastructure — not just "moving to the cloud" as a buzzword exercise. We evaluate your current hosting, application architecture, data storage, and cost structure, then design a cloud migration plan that actually reduces costs and improves reliability. For Energy businesses in Opal, Wyoming, that means choosing between AWS, Azure, Google Cloud, and self-hosted solutions based on your specific workload, compliance requirements, and budget.

Our cloud builds for Opal businesses include infrastructure setup (servers, databases, networking), application deployment automation (CI/CD pipelines, container orchestration), and cost optimization monitoring. For Energy operations in Opal, we pay particular attention to data residency requirements, backup and disaster recovery, and auto-scaling configurations that handle traffic spikes without overprovisioning during quiet periods.

Cloud consulting for Opal businesses runs 2-6 weeks depending on migration complexity. Simple application migrations (single app to cloud hosting) deploy in days. Multi-system migrations with database migration, DNS cutover, and zero-downtime requirements take 4-6 weeks. Every deployment includes monitoring, alerting, and runbooks so your Opal team can operate the infrastructure independently.

For energy businesses in Opal, the economics of AI automation are straightforward: most implementations pay for themselves within 60-90 days through labor savings alone. The math works because automation doesn't replace people — it replaces the lowest-value hours on your team's calendar. Data entry, manual follow-ups, report generation, system-to-system copy-paste — these tasks cost $25-$50/hour in loaded labor but cost fractions of a cent per execution when automated.

For Opal businesses comparing vendors, the key differentiator is total cost of ownership. Platform-based automation (Zapier Business at $599/month, HubSpot Operations at $800/month) costs $7,200-$9,600/year — every year, forever, with pricing that increases as your usage grows. Our one-time build fee of $2,500-$10,000 is a permanent asset with operational costs of $30-$150/month in AI provider fees. Over 3 years, the savings compound to $15,000-$25,000 or more.
